Output d32c7ab67d47b9db67847eef0c84ea5a90323c5261a58bfeed8a3da092977391: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0bd63a70d96e95f75709e2d9036201203ba2462 OP_EQUAL
address
3HoXjJXJ5CPePN1E5GDdukcDxoadDzWcse
transaction
d32c7ab67d47b9db67847eef0c84ea5a90323c5261a58bfeed8a3da092977391
confirmations
406996
spent
true